How does Law 475 on Jurisdictional Demarcation in Bolivia influence the compliance strategies of companies and what measures should they adopt to avoid legal conflicts related to territorial jurisdiction?
Law 475 regulates jurisdictional demarcation in Bolivia. Companies must adjust their compliance strategies to avoid legal conflicts related to territorial jurisdiction. This involves the constant review of territorial limits, collaboration with government entities to obtain updated information and participation in delimitation processes. Maintaining a specialized legal team, being aware of changes in territorial legislation and respecting the provisions of Law 475 are essential steps to comply with the regulations.

Are there rehabilitation programs for people with judicial records in Bolivia?
In Bolivia, there are rehabilitation programs aimed at people with judicial records. These programs may include job training, psychological counseling, and other initiatives to facilitate social reintegration. It is advisable to contact governmental or non-governmental organizations working in the field of rehabilitation to obtain specific information about available programs.
How are juvenile offender cases handled in the Guatemalan legal system?
Juvenile offender cases are handled through a specialized juvenile justice system in Guatemala. The rehabilitation and reintegration of young offenders is sought, and different measures are applied to those of adults.
